Position Summary
Manager/Director, Benefits temporary role to cover five month employee leave - focused skill set on health and welfare plans, including absence and leave, global benefits in Canada, EU and India, Workday experience preferred
  • Huron requires a Bachelor’s Degree in a field related to this position or equivalent work experience
  • In-depth health benefits and disability/leave/ADA experience, including plan design, vendor management, program communication and change mangement
  • Design and management of well-being programs in collaboration with Employee Experience, ERG groups, HRBPs and others
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and demonstrate flexibility to adapt to shifting de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• Leads benefits benchmarking and survey completion and interpretation.
  • Ensures compliance with IRS and DOL rules and regulations
  • Designs global benefits framework and country-specific plan designs, focused on Canada, EU, India, and Singapore
  • Ensures delivery of consistent, competitive, employee-focused benefits experience as part of Huron's EVP and corporate values.
  • Prepares benefits presentations for leadership and Board of Directors
  • 3+ years benefits supervisory experience
  • Drives contract and renewal negotiations in partnership with contracted benefits consultant
  • 8 + years of Human Resources-related experience, specifically with managing employee benefits programs
  • Strong project management skills
  • Designs three-to-five-year global benefits strategy.
  • Proven ability to work collaboratively across team members and departments, such as Compensation, Employee Experience, Legal, Finance, Business Partners and others
  • Develops and interprets benefits financials and data analytics, as well as developing KPIs
  • Prioritizes and provides business case for program enhancements.
  • Manages and advice on escalated benefits issues
Preferred Skills:
  • Strong attention to detail, ability to multi-task
  • Global benefits design, delivery and management
  • Strong benefits technical skills
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, as well as interpersonal skills
  • Experience in managing HRIS for benefits, with Workday experience strongly desired.
  • Proven ability to identify, research and implement benefit enhancements that will support Huron's Employee Value Proposition to attract and retain key talent.
  • Proven track record in identifying process improvements to achieve efficiencies and team success.
  • Strong knowledge of FMLA, ADA and employee leave regulations and accommodations, including business partnership
